There is a theory behind it I heard a while ago. Sephiroth's physical body was badly damaged when Cloud threw him into the mako stream in the Nibelheim reactor, leaving him in a state similar to Cloud's at Mideel. This means that throughout the game, the player only deals with Sephiroth's conciousness, explaining how he can move so fast from town to town in disc 1. The final fight isn't with Sephiroth, but with his mental projection of himself (Bizarro Sephiroth). Once beaten in this form, Sephiroth realises he can't afford to mess around any more and forces Cloud to battle with him with all his remaining strength as a non-physical being (Saviour Sephiroth). Once beaten, Sephiroth drags Cloud into his stream of consiousness for one last battle. Sephiroth has no strength left, and is only able to take the form that Cloud remembers; a man with a bloody great sword. Cloud uses his full strength to defeat Sephiroth for good, using his Omnilash to do so. This is why Cloud appears in a daze when Tifa shouts at him when the crater collapses, he's been fighting Sephiroth in his mind.
